ABSTRACT

Introduction: Women with kidney failure have impaired fertility and are at a higher risk of maternal and fetal morbidity and mortality. Little is known about pregnancies in women receiving maintenance home dialysis in the United States. Methods: Using data from the United States Renal Data System (USRDS), a cohort of 26,387 women aged 15 to 49 years with kidney failure receiving maintenance home dialysis from 2005 to 2018 was examined. We calculated pregnancy rates and identified factors, including the modality associated with pregnancy receiving home dialysis. Results: Overall, 437 pregnancies were identified in 26,837 women on home dialysis. The unadjusted pregnancy rate was 8.6 per 1000 person-years (PTPY). The unadjusted pregnancy rate was higher on home hemodialysis (16.0 vs. 7.5 PTPY) than on peritoneal dialysis. Women receiving home hemodialysis had a higher adjusted likelihood of pregnancy than women receiving peritoneal dialysis (hazard ratio [HR], 2.34; 95% confidence interval [CI], 1.79-3.05). Compared with women aged 20 to 24 years, the likelihood of pregnancy was lower in women aged 30 to 34 years (HR, 0.64; 95% CI, 0.43-0.96), 35 to 39 years (HR, 0.53; 95% CI, 0.35-0.79), 40 to 44 years (HR, 0.32; 95% CI, 0.21-0.49), and 45 to 49 years (HR, 0.21; 95% CI, 0.13-0.33). Whereas Black women had a higher likelihood of pregnancy (HR, 1.40; 95% CI, 1.07-1.83), there was no difference in likelihood of pregnancy in Asian, Hispanic, and Native Americans as compared to Whites. Body mass index, cause of kidney failure, socioeconomic status, rurality, predialysis nephrology care, or dialysis vintage were not significantly associated with pregnancy on home dialysis. Conclusion: The pregnancy rate in women with kidney failure undergoing home dialysis is higher with home hemodialysis than with peritoneal dialysis. Younger age and Black race or ethnicity are associated with a higher likelihood of pregnancy among women receiving home dialysis. This information can guide clinicians in preconception counselling and making informed treatment decisions for pregnant women on home dialysis.

ABSTRACT

RATIONALE & OBJECTIVE: A history of prior abdominal procedures may influence the likelihood of referral for peritoneal dialysis (PD) catheter insertion. To guide clinical decision making in this population, this study examined the association between prior abdominal procedures and outcomes in patients undergoing PD catheter insertion. STUDY DESIGN: Retrospective cohort study. SETTING & PARTICIPANTS: Adults undergoing their first PD catheter insertion between November 1, 2011, and November 1, 2020, at 11 institutions in Canada and the United States participating in the International Society for Peritoneal Dialysis North American Catheter Registry. EXPOSURE: Prior abdominal procedure(s) defined as any procedure that enters the peritoneal cavity. OUTCOMES: The primary outcome was time to the first of (1) abandonment of the PD catheter or (2) interruption/termination of PD. Secondary outcomes were rates of emergency room visits, hospitalizations, and procedures. ANALYTICAL APPROACH: Cumulative incidence curves were used to describe the risk over time, and an adjusted Cox proportional hazards model was used to estimate the association between the exposure and primary outcome. Models for count data were used to estimate the associations between the exposure and secondary outcomes. RESULTS: Of 855 patients who met the inclusion criteria, 31% had a history of a prior abdominal procedure and 20% experienced at least 1 PD catheter-related complication that led to the primary outcome. Prior abdominal procedures were not associated with an increased risk of the primary outcome (adjusted HR, 1.12; 95% CI, 0.68-1.84). Upper-abdominal procedures were associated with a higher adjusted hazard of the primary outcome, but there was no dose-response relationship concerning the number of procedures. There was no association between prior abdominal procedures and other secondary outcomes. LIMITATIONS: Observational study and cohort limited to a sample of patients believed to be potential candidates for PD catheter insertion. CONCLUSION: A history of prior abdominal procedure(s) does not appear to influence catheter outcomes following PD catheter insertion. Such a history should not be a contraindication to PD. PLAIN-LANGUAGE SUMMARY: Peritoneal dialysis (PD) is a life-saving therapy for individuals with kidney failure that can be done at home. PD requires the placement of a tube, or catheter, into the abdomen to allow the exchange of dialysis fluid during treatment. There is concern that individuals who have undergone prior abdominal procedures and are referred for a catheter might have scarring that could affect catheter function. In some institutions, they might not even be offered PD therapy as an option. In this study, we found that a history of prior abdominal procedures did not increase the risk of PD catheter complications and should not dissuade patients from choosing PD or providers from recommending it.

ABSTRACT

OBJECTIVES: Peritoneal dialysis (PD) allows patients increased autonomy and flexibility; however, both infectious and non-infectious complications may lead to technique failure, which shortens treatment longevity. Maintaining patients on PD remains a major challenge for nephrologists. This study aims to describe nephrologists' perspectives on technique survival in PD. DESIGN: Qualitative semistructured interview study. Transcripts were thematically analysed. SETTING AND PARTICIPANTS: 30 nephrologists across 11 countries including Australia, the USA, the UK, Hong Kong, Canada, Singapore, Japan, New Zealand, Thailand, Colombia and Uruguay were interviewed from April 2017 to November 2019. RESULTS: We identified four themes: defining patient suitability (confidence in capacity for self-management, ensuring clinical stability and expected resilience), building endurance (facilitating access to practical support, improving mental well-being, optimising quality of care and training to reduce risk of complications), establishing rapport through effective communications (managing expectations to enhance trust, individualising care and harnessing a multidisciplinary approach) and confronting fear and acknowledging barriers to haemodialysis (preventing crash landing to haemodialysis, facing concerns of losing independence and positive framing of haemodialysis). CONCLUSION: Nephrologists reported that technique survival in PD is influenced by patients' medical circumstances, psychological motivation and positively influenced by the education and support provided by treating clinicians and families. Strategies to enhance patients' knowledge on PD and communication with patients about technique survival in PD are needed to build trust, set patient expectations of treatment and improve the process of transition off PD.

ABSTRACT

BACKGROUND: Mineral bone disorder (MBD) in chronic kidney disease (CKD) is associated with high symptom burden, fractures, vascular calcification, cardiovascular disease and increased morbidity and mortality. CKD-MBD studies have been limited in peritoneal dialysis (PD) patients. Here, we describe calcium and parathyroid hormone (PTH) control, related treatments and mortality associations in PD patients. METHODS: We used data from eight countries (Australia and New Zealand (A/NZ), Canada, Japan, Thailand, South Korea, United Kingdom, United States (US)) participating in the prospective cohort Peritoneal Dialysis Outcomes and Practice Patterns Study (2014-2022) among patients receiving PD for >3 months. We analysed the association of baseline PTH and albumin-adjusted calcium (calciumAlb) with all-cause mortality using Cox regression, adjusted for potential confounders, including serum phosphorus and alkaline phosphatase. RESULTS: Mean age ranged from 54.6 years in South Korea to 63.5 years in Japan. PTH and serum calciumAlb were measured at baseline in 12,642 and 14,244 patients, respectively. Median PTH ranged from 161 (Japan) to 363 pg/mL (US); mean calciumAlb ranged from 9.1 (South Korea, US) to 9.8 mg/dL (A/NZ). The PTH/mortality relationship was U-shaped, with the lowest risk at PTH 300-599 pg/mL. Mortality was nearly 20% higher at serum calciumAlb 9.6+ mg/dL versus 8.4-<9.6 mg/dL. MBD therapy prescriptions varied substantially across countries. CONCLUSIONS: A large proportion of PD patients in this multi-national study have calcium and/or PTH levels in ranges associated with substantially higher mortality. These observations point to the need to substantially improve MBD management in PD to optimise patient outcomes. LAY SUMMARY: Chronic kidney disease-mineral bone disorder (MBD) is a systemic condition, common in dialysis patients, that results in abnormalities in parathyroid hormone (PTH), calcium, phosphorus and vitamin D metabolism. A large proportion of peritoneal dialysis (PD) patients in this current multi-national study had calcium and/or PTH levels in ranges associated with substantially higher risks of death. Our observational study design limits our ability to determine whether these abnormal calcium and PTH levels cause more death due to possible confounding that was not accounted for in our analysis. However, our findings, along with other recent work showing 48-75% higher risk of death for the one-third of PD patients having high phosphorus levels (>5.5 mg/dL), should raise strong concerns for a greater focus on improving MBD management in PD patients.

ABSTRACT

Catheter-related tunnel infection may lead to peritonitis and discontinuation of performing high-quality peritoneal dialysis (PD). Tunnel infection is commonly caused by Staphylococcus aureus. Gas-forming bacterial infection is rare in patients with PD and even exceedingly rare when such a infection spreads along the PD catheter tract. The first case of emphysematous PD catheter infection is presented here.

ABSTRACT

Introduction: The potential value of serum galactomannan index (GMI) in monitoring treatment response in patients with fungal peritonitis who are receiving peritoneal dialysis (PD) was assessed in the present study. Methods: The study included all Thailand fungal PD-related infectious complications surveillance (MycoPDICS) DATA study participants who had timely PD catheter removal and availability of both baseline and ≥2 subsequent serum GMI measurements after starting antifungal therapy (if available). Serum GMI was assessed by direct double-sandwich enzyme-linked immunosorbent assay with reference to positive and negative control samples. Comparisons of categorical variables among groups were analyzed by Fisher's exact test for categorical data and the Wilcoxon rank-sum test for continuous variables. Mortality outcomes were analyzed by survival analyses using Kaplan-Meier curves with Log-rank test. Results: Seventy-six (46%) of 166 participants from 21 PD centers between 2018 and 2022 were included. The median age was 58 (50-65) years, and a half of the patients (50%) had type II diabetes. Nineteen (25%) and 57 (75%) episodes were caused by yeast and mold, respectively. Death occurred in 11 (14%) patients at 3 months, and no differences were observed in demographics, laboratories, treatment characteristics, or in baseline serum GMI between those who died and those who survived. Serum GMI progressively declined over the follow-up period after the completion of treatment. Patients who died had significantly higher posttreatment serum GMI levels and were more likely to have positive GMI after treatment. Conclusion: Serum GMI is an excellent biomarker for risk stratification and treatment response monitoring in patients on PD with fungal peritonitis.

ABSTRACT

BACKGROUND: This study investigated the association of intra-abdominal adhesions with the risk of peritoneal dialysis (PD) catheter complications. METHODS: Individuals undergoing laparoscopic PD catheter insertion were prospectively enrolled from eight centers in Canada and the United States. Patients were grouped based on the presence of adhesions observed during catheter insertion. The primary outcome was the composite of PD never starting, termination of PD, or the need for an invasive procedure caused by flow restriction or abdominal pain. RESULTS: Seven hundred and fifty-eight individuals were enrolled, of whom 201 (27%) had adhesions during laparoscopic PD catheter insertion. The risk of the primary outcome occurred in 35 (17%) in the adhesion group compared with 58 (10%) in the no adhesion group (adjusted HR, 1.64; 95% confidence interval [CI], 1.05 to 2.55) within 6 months of insertion. Lower abdominal or pelvic adhesions had an adjusted HR of 1.80 (95% CI, 1.09 to 2.98) compared with the no adhesion group. Invasive procedures were required in 26 (13%) and 47 (8%) of the adhesion and no adhesion groups, respectively (unadjusted HR, 1.60: 95% CI, 1.04 to 2.47) within 6 months of insertion. The adjusted odds ratio for adhesions for women was 1.65 (95% CI, 1.12 to 2.41), for body mass index per 5 kg/m 2 was 1.16 (95% CI, 1.003 to 1.34), and for prior abdominal surgery was 8.34 (95% CI, 5.5 to 12.34). Common abnormalities found during invasive procedures included PD catheter tip migration, occlusion of the lumen with fibrin, omental wrapping, adherence to the bowel, and the development of new adhesions. CONCLUSIONS: People with intra-abdominal adhesions undergoing PD catheter insertion were at higher risk for abdominal pain or flow restriction preventing PD from starting, PD termination, or requiring an invasive procedure. However, most patients, with or without adhesions, did not experience complications, and most complications did not lead to the termination of PD therapy.

ABSTRACT

RATIONALE & OBJECTIVE: The integrated home dialysis model proposes the initiation of kidney replacement therapy (KRT) with peritoneal dialysis (PD) and a timely transition to home hemodialysis (HHD) after PD ends. We compared the outcomes of patients transitioning from PD to HHD with those initiating KRT with HHD. STUDY DESIGN: Observational analysis of the Canadian Organ Replacement Register (CORR). SETTINGS & PARTICIPANTS: All patients who initiated PD or HHD within the first 90 days of KRT between 2005 and 2018. EXPOSURE: Patients transitioning from PD to HHD (PD+HHD group) versus patients initiating KRT with HHD (HHD group). OUTCOME: (1) A composite of all-cause mortality and modality transfer (to in-center hemodialysis or PD for 90 days) and (2) all hospitalizations (considered as recurrent events). ANALYTICAL APPROACH: A propensity score analysis for which PD+HHD patients were matched 1:1 to (1) incident HHD patients ("incident-match" analysis) or (2) HHD patients with a KRT vintage at least equivalent to the vintage of PD+HHD patients at the transition time ("vintage-matched" analysis). Cause-specific hazards models (composite outcome) and shared frailty models (hospitalization) were used to compare groups. RESULTS: Among 63,327 individuals in the CORR, 163 PD+HHD patients (median of 1.9 years in PD) and 711 HHD patients were identified. In the incident-match analysis, compared to the HHD patients, the PD+HHD group had a similar risk of the composite outcome (HR, 0.88 [95% CI, 0.58-1.32]) and hospitalizations (HR, 1.04 [95% CI, 0.76-1.41]). In the vintage-match analysis, PD+HHD patients had a lower hazard for the composite outcome (HR, 0.61 [95% CI, 0.40-0.94]) but a similar hospitalization risk (HR, 0.85 [95% CI, 0.59-1.24]). LIMITATIONS: Risk of survivor bias in the PD+HHD cohort and residual confounding. CONCLUSIONS: Controlling for KRT vintage, the patients transitioning from PD to HHD had better clinical outcomes than the incident HHD patients. These data support the use of integrated home dialysis for patients initiating home-based KRT. PLAIN-LANGUAGE SUMMARY: The integrated home dialysis model proposes the initiation of dialysis with peritoneal dialysis (PD) and subsequent transition to home hemodialysis (HHD) once PD is no longer feasible. It allows patients to benefit from initial lifestyle advantages of PD and to continue home-based treatments after its termination. However, some patients may prefer to initiate dialysis with HHD from the outset. In this study, we compared the long-term clinical outcomes of both approaches using a large Canadian dialysis register. We found that both options led to a similar risk of hospitalization. In contrast, the PD-to-HHD model led to improved survival when controlling for the duration of kidney failure.

ABSTRACT

In 2021, a committee was commissioned by the Canadian Society of Nephrology to comment on the 2021 National Kidney Foundation-American Society of Nephrology Task Force recommendations on the use of race in glomerular filtration rate estimating equations. The committee met on numerous occasions and agreed on several recommendations. However, the committee did not achieve unanimity, with a minority group disagreeing with the scope of the commentary. As a result, this report presents the viewpoint of the majority members. We endorsed many of the recommendations from the National Kidney Foundation-American Society of Nephrology Task Force, most importantly that race should be removed from the estimated glomerular filtration rate creatinine-based equation. We recommend an immediate implementation of the new Chronic Kidney Disease Epidemiology Collaboration equation (2021), which does not discriminate among any group while maintaining precision. Additionally, we recommend that Canadian laboratories and provincial kidney organizations advocate for increased testing and access to cystatin C because the combination of cystatin C and creatinine in revised equations leads to more precise estimates. Finally, we recommend that future research studies evaluating the implementation of the new equations and changes to screening, diagnosis, and management across provincial health programs be prioritized in Canada.

ABSTRACT

Neutralization of Omicron subvariants by different bivalent vaccines has not been well evaluated. This study characterizes neutralization against Omicron subvariants in 98 individuals on dialysis or with a kidney transplant receiving the BNT162b2 (BA.4/BA.5) or mRNA-1273 (BA.1) bivalent COVID-19 vaccine. Neutralization against Omicron BA.1, BA.5, BQ.1.1, and XBB.1.5 increased by 8-fold one month following bivalent vaccination. In comparison to wild-type (D614G), neutralizing antibodies against Omicron-specific variants were 7.3-fold lower against BA.1, 8.3-fold lower against BA.5, 45.8-fold lower against BQ.1.1, and 48.2-fold lower against XBB.1.5. Viral neutralization was not significantly different by bivalent vaccine type for wild-type (D614G) (P = 0.48), BA.1 (P = 0.21), BA.5 (P = 0.07), BQ.1.1 (P = 0.10), nor XBB.1.5 (P = 0.10). Hybrid immunity conferred higher neutralizing antibodies against all Omicron subvariants. This study provides evidence that BNT162b2 (BA.4/BA.5) and mRNA-1273 (BA.1) induce similar neutralization against Omicron subvariants, even when antigenically divergent from the circulating variant.

ABSTRACT

AIM: To assess whether the peritoneal dialysis (PD) centres included in the Peritoneal Dialysis Outcomes and Practise Patterns Study (PDOPPS) in Thailand are representative of other PD centres in the country, based on 8 key performance indicators (KPIs 1-8). METHODS: A retrospective analysis was conducted comparing PD-related clinical outcomes between PD centres included in the PDOPPS (the PDOPPS group) and those not included (the non-PDOPPS group) from January 2018 to December 2019. Logistic regression analysis was used to identify predictors associated with achieving the target KPIs. RESULTS: Of 181 PD centres, 22 (12%) were included in the PDOPPS. PD centres in the PDOPPS group were larger and tended to serve more PD patients than those in the non-PDOPPS group. However, the process and outcome KPIs (KPIs 1-8) were comparable between the 2 groups. Large hospitals (≥120 beds), providing care to ≥100 PD cases and having experience for >10 years were independent predictors of achieving the peritonitis rate target of <0.5 episodes/year. Most PD centres in Thailand showed weaknesses in off-target haemoglobin levels and culture-negative peritonitis rate. CONCLUSIONS: The PD centres included in Thai PDOPPS were found to be representative of other PD centres in Thailand in terms of clinical outcomes. Thus, Thai PDOPPS findings may apply to the broader PD population in Thailand.
